TIME XPRO 10 – PERFORMANCE-PEDAL MIT OPTIMIERTEM PEDAL CENTER

Die TIME XPRO 10 Pedale überzeugen durch ein exzellentes Verhältnis von geringem Gewicht und hoher Stabilität. Der Carbon-Composite-Pedalkörper wird mit einer hohlen Stahlachse kombiniert und bietet damit eine langlebige, hochbelastbare Konstruktion – ideal für ambitionierte Fahrer, die ein robustes Klickpedal suchen. Dank der ICLIC-Technologie lässt sich der Einstieg besonders mühelos realisieren, während das flache Profil die Aerodynamik optimiert.

Dieses Modell verfügt über ein Pedal Center von 53 mm (Abstand von Pedalmitte zu Kurbelarm). Diese Bauweise ermöglicht eine kompakte Standbreite für eine effiziente Beinführung und direkte Kraftübertragung. Die großzügige Aufstandsfläche von 725 mm² sorgt für maximale Stabilität bei jedem Tritt. Die Carbon-Blattfeder lässt sich zudem in drei Stufen in der Auslösehärte verstellen.

Produktdetails & Funktionen
Carbon-Composite: Leichter Pedalkörper mit integrierter Edelstahlplatte
ICLIC-System: Schnelles, sicheres Einklicken durch voreingestellten Mechanismus
Biomechanik: Axialer Spielraum (±1,25 mm) und Fersenrotation (±5°) zur Knieschonung
Belastbarkeit: Robuste Stahl-Hohlachse ohne Gewichtsbeschränkung für den Fahrer
Effizienz: Sehr niedrige Bauhöhe für eine direkte Verbindung zum Antrieb

Daten & Identifikation
Marke: TIME | Modell: XPRO 10
Pedal Center: 53 mm | Farbe: Carbon / Schwarz

Lieferumfang
1 Paar TIME XPRO 10 Pedale. (Hinweis: Die Lieferung erfolgt ohne Cleats).

Technische Daten
Achse: Stahl (hohl) | Körper: Carbon-Verbundstoff
Aufstandsfläche: 725 mm² | Auslösewinkel: 16°
Gewicht: ca. 246 g (Paar, ohne Cleats und Schrauben)

Wichtiger technischer Hinweis
Zubehör: Bitte beachten Sie, dass dieses Angebot **keine Cleats** (Schuhplatten) beinhaltet. Für die Nutzung werden TIME ICLIC Cleats benötigt. Das Pedal Center von 53 mm ist der Standardwert für eine klassische Rennrad-Geometrie.

Fazit
Die TIME XPRO 10 mit 53 mm Pedal Center sind die perfekte Wahl für Racer, die ein leichtes, steifes und langlebiges Klickpedal für Training und Wettkampf suchen.
